## Heat of Fusion The heat of fusion is the energy absorbed during melting at constant temperature. ### Formula **Q = m * L_f** where L_f is the specific latent heat of fusion. For water/ice, L_f = 334,000 J/kg = 334 kJ/kg.

Melting 1 kg of ice at 0°C.

  1. 01Q = m * Lf
  2. 02Q = 1 * 334000
  3. 03Q = 334,000 J = 334 kJ

Does temperature change during melting?

No. During a phase change, all added energy goes into breaking intermolecular bonds, not raising temperature.

What is the heat of fusion for water?

334 kJ/kg (334,000 J/kg or about 80 cal/g). This is why ice is so effective at cooling drinks.

Is freezing the reverse of melting?

Yes. The same amount of energy released during freezing equals the energy absorbed during melting.
